The 'hired guns' become the fired guns

The global credit crisis has forced many financial institutions to turn to a new breed of CEO, the "hired gun." The mess many of these companies have gotten themselves into, however, has become just too big for any CEO to dig out of, resulting in stints that are growing ever shorter as companies either fail or sell. ...


How J.P. Morgan did the deals during the storm

Since the beginning of the credit crisis, J.P. Morgan Chase & Co. has been like a bride-to-be at the Filene's Basement Bridal Gown Sale grabbing anything that looks good. First it was Bear Stearns Cos. in March, and now Washington Mutual Inc. Both were snagged at steep discounts, and with the government's blessing. Most experts agree the unions, which will help it vault past Citigroup Inc. to become the second-largest bank, will pay off for the New York-based firm down the road. So, how was J.P. Morgan able to make these transformative marriages possible? ...
